Practice Overview

Thunderbird Veterinary Hospital is a well-established, progressive, fast-paced multi-doctor small animal and exotic practice located in Norman, Oklahoma. We offer many services to provide the best comprehensive care to our patients including Preventative Care, Surgery, Urgent Care, High Speed Dentistry, Cold Laser Therapy, In-House Diagnostics, Digital radiology, Medical and/or Vacation Boarding and more.

Dr. Susan Mack and Dr. Michelle Corr built Thunderbird Veterinary Hospital in 1993. They were classmates at OSU and graduated in 1987. After working for other veterinarians they decided to open their own practice in the Little Axe community near Lake Thunderbird. They both wanted to have a mixed animal practice and built their clinic accordingly. If you build it, they will come. And come they did!

Our hours of operation are: Monday – Thursday: 9:00am – 6:00pm Friday: 9:00am – 2:00pm Sat: 9:00am – 12:00pm We are closed on Sundays To learn more about us click here.  Job Description Job duties include, but are not limited to: Maintain the visual appeal or the hospital reception area, greet and welcome clients and patients, answer questions and triage client concerns, answer calls or emails and direct to the appropriate party for resolution, schedule appointments to maximize efficiency and daily flow, check in and check out clients and process payments. Our receptionists offer friendly emotional support in a compassionate and discreet manner during times of need to our clients and must be comfortable with various medical outcomes. Must be able to withstand unpleasant odors and noises. May be exposed to bites, scratches, animal waste and potentially contagious diseases. Whether you’re looking to just be a master of your role or trying to grow into that next career move, you’ll have opportunities through a variety of virtual and hands on, interactive training and continuing development. Qualifications We’re looking for: Experienced Receptionist with a minimum of 1-year veterinary experience  Compassionate, Calm, Team Player, Multi-Tasker and Strong Communicator Highly organized and possess computer skills Self-starter with the desire to continue to advance your knowledge and skillset.
